|
Revenue from Contracts with Customers - Schedule of Sales Reserves and Allowances (Detail)
$ in Millions
|9 Months Ended
|
Sep. 30, 2019
USD ($)
|Revenue Recognition [Line Items]
|Balance at beginning of period
|$ 6,886
|Provisions related to sales made in current year period
|12,797
|Provisions related to sales made in prior periods
|(12)
|Credits and payments
|(13,359)
|Translation differences
|(19)
|Balance at end of period
|6,293
|Reserves Included in Accounts Receivable, Net [Member]
|Revenue Recognition [Line Items]
|Balance at beginning of period
|175
|Provisions related to sales made in current year period
|334
|Provisions related to sales made in prior periods
|3
|Credits and payments
|(356)
|Balance at end of period
|156
|Rebates [Member]
|Revenue Recognition [Line Items]
|Balance at beginning of period
|3,006
|Provisions related to sales made in current year period
|4,004
|Provisions related to sales made in prior periods
|(28)
|Credits and payments
|(4,276)
|Translation differences
|(14)
|Balance at end of period
|2,692
|Medicaid and Other Governmental Allowances [Member]
|Revenue Recognition [Line Items]
|Balance at beginning of period
|1,361
|Provisions related to sales made in current year period
|760
|Provisions related to sales made in prior periods
|(2)
|Credits and payments
|(882)
|Translation differences
|(4)
|Balance at end of period
|1,233
|Chargebacks [Member]
|Revenue Recognition [Line Items]
|Balance at beginning of period
|1,530
|Provisions related to sales made in current year period
|7,196
|Provisions related to sales made in prior periods
|(1)
|Credits and payments
|(7,299)
|Translation differences
|(1)
|Balance at end of period
|1,425
|Returns [Member]
|Revenue Recognition [Line Items]
|Balance at beginning of period
|638
|Provisions related to sales made in current year period
|195
|Provisions related to sales made in prior periods
|23
|Credits and payments
|(251)
|Translation differences
|(1)
|Balance at end of period
|604
|Other [Member]
|Revenue Recognition [Line Items]
|Balance at beginning of period
|176
|Provisions related to sales made in current year period
|308
|Provisions related to sales made in prior periods
|(7)
|Credits and payments
|(295)
|Translation differences
|1
|Balance at end of period
|183
|Total Reserves Included in Sales Reserves and Allowances [Member]
|Revenue Recognition [Line Items]
|Balance at beginning of period
|6,711
|Provisions related to sales made in current year period
|12,463
|Provisions related to sales made in prior periods
|(15)
|Credits and payments
|(13,003)
|Translation differences
|(19)
|Balance at end of period
|$ 6,137
|X
- Definition
+ References
Revenue Recognition [Line Items]
+ Details
No definition available.
|X
- Definition
+ References
Valuation allowances and reserves foreign currency translation.
+ Details
No definition available.
|X
- Definition
+ References
Valuation allowances and reserves related to current period sales.
+ Details
No definition available.
|X
- Definition
+ References
Valuation allowances and reserves related to prior period sales.
+ Details
No definition available.
|X
- Definition
+ References
Amount of valuation and qualifying accounts and reserves.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of decrease in valuation and qualifying accounts and reserves.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details